[PATCH v5 0/5] support a new type of PMIC,including two chips(rk817 and rk809)

From: Tony Xie
Date: Tue Oct 23 2018 - 07:31:56 EST


Most of functions and registers of the rk817 and rk808 are the same,
so they can share allmost all codes.

Their specifications are as follows£º
1) The RK809 and RK809 consist of 5 DCDCs, 9 LDOs and have the same registers
for these components except dcdc5.
2) The dcdc5 is a boost dcdc for RK817 and is a buck for RK809.
3) The RK817 has one switch but The Rk809 has two.
